S 796 New Jersey Senate · 2026-2027 Regular Session

Permits public and nonpublic schools to utilize security categorical aid to hire school security personnel.

S 796 (New Jersey Senate Bill) allows school districts to use existing security categorical aid funding to hire school security personnel for both public and nonpublic schools within their district. The bill amends the "Secure Schools for All Children Act" to explicitly state that security services - including hiring security staff - can be paid for with this dedicated funding. Currently, school districts must provide security services to nonpublic school students, but this clarifies that hiring security personnel is an approved use of the existing security funding. The change makes current Department of Education guidance about allowable security expenditures consistent with the law.
